What You'll Experience

  • 🏛️ Registan Square – The most iconic landmark of Uzbekistan and one of the greatest architectural ensembles of the Silk Road.
  • 👑 Gur-e-Amir Mausoleum – The magnificent resting place of the conqueror Timur (Tamerlane).
  • 🫖 Lyabi Hauz – A historic plaza surrounded by centuries-old madrasahs and traditional teahouses.
  • 🗼 Kalyan Minaret – An 800-year-old masterpiece and symbol of Bukhara.
  • ⭐ Amir Temur Square – The heart of modern Tashkent, dedicated to Central Asia's legendary ruler.
  • 🚇 Tashkent Metro – One of the world's most beautiful metro systems, famous for its unique Soviet-era station designs.
  • 🏔️ Issyk-Kul Lake – The world's second-largest alpine lake, surrounded by spectacular mountain scenery.
  • 🏜️ Skazka Canyon – A colorful canyon known for its dramatic red rock formations and unique landscapes.
  • ⛰️ Jeti-Oguz Canyon – One of Kyrgyzstan's most famous natural attractions, featuring striking red sandstone cliffs.
  • 🕌 Dungan Mosque – A unique Chinese-style wooden mosque built without nails.
  • 🏞️ Charyn Canyon – Kazakhstan's most famous canyon, often compared to the Grand Canyon.
  • 🌄 Kok Tobe – A scenic hilltop viewpoint offering panoramic views of Almaty and the surrounding mountains.
  • ⛪ Zenkov Cathedral – One of the world's tallest wooden cathedrals and a landmark of Kazakhstan.
  • 🏰 Khujand Fortress – An ancient stronghold dating back more than 2,500 years and linked to Alexander the Great.
  • 🛍️ Panjshanbe Bazaar – One of Central Asia's largest and most vibrant traditional markets.
  • 🗽 Independence Monument – A symbol of modern Turkmenistan and one of Ashgabat's most recognizable landmarks.
  • ⚖️ Arch of Neutrality – A famous monument reflecting Turkmenistan's policy of neutrality.
  • 🔥 Darvaza Gas Crater (optional excursion) – The legendary "Door to Hell," a giant burning natural gas crater in the Karakum Desert.
  • 🏺 Old Nisa (optional excursion) – A UNESCO World Heritage Site and former capital of the ancient Parthian Empire.
